The Kiss (1896) was a short film that actually featured the first on-screen kiss between actors John C. Rice and May Irwin. This was one of the earliest films to show a romantic scene and caused quite a controversy in Victorian times. In literary and dramatic terms, a foil is a character whose qualities contrast with another character (usually the protagonist) to highlight specific traits. For example, a serious character might be paired with a comic foil to emphasize their seriousness.

Voice-over is a production technique where a voice that is not part of the on-screen dialogue provides narration, commentary, or character thoughts. It's distinct from dubbing, which replaces dialogue in another language.
